Mulhouse Church Tower In France
Keywords
church,
france,
st,
saint,
alsace,
temple,
protestant,
gothic,
revival,
modern,
contemporary,
french,
landmark,
historic,
building,
historical building,
religious,
architecture,
worship,
site,
place